About P. Nevski

P. Nevski is a scholar working on Information Systems and Management, Nuclear and High Energy Physics, Radiation, Computer Networks and Communications and Condensed Matter Physics, having authored 12 papers that have together received 107 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Distributed and Parallel Computing Systems (7 papers), Advanced Data Storage Technologies (5 papers), Scientific Computing and Data Management (5 papers), Particle physics theoretical and experimental studies (4 papers), Particle Detector Development and Performance (4 papers), Radiation Detection and Scintillator Technologies (3 papers), Atomic and Subatomic Physics Research (2 papers) and Cosmology and Gravitation Theories (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Nuclear and High Energy Physics (82 citations), Radiation (41 citations), Information Systems and Management (13 citations), Computer Networks and Communications (30 citations) and Hardware and Architecture (6 citations). P. Nevski has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Switzerland and Russia. Frequent co-authors include V. A. Kantserov, I. L. Gavrilenko, A. Kraan, J. B. Hansen, A. Shmeleva, B. A. Dolgoshein, W. Willis, C. Fabjan, A. Vaniachine and V. Chernyatin.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Physics Conference Series, Nuclear Instruments and Methods, Nuclear Instruments and Methods in Physics Research, University of North Texas Digital Library (University of North Texas) and CERN Document Server (European Organization for Nuclear Research).
